I just got this old motorcycle for a pretty good deal, its a 1981 yamaha seca. I have got it running and idling like new, the thing is that it has a shaft drive instead of a belt/chain, I was think about cutting the whole rear end out of my cart, and welding the frame from the motorcycle up and have it bolt to a cushmen rear end. any different rear end ideas? I heard an rx7, corrolla, or a cushmen rear end will work?

That is a right angle gear box exactly. With your dads help making the hubs to attach the shaft should be easy. Don't spend hundreds in man hours building the box itself when they are readily available. Your drawing is right on, minus the 4 bearings to support the shafts. Buy a made up box that will be a sealed unit to hold lube and simply bolt it in place and fab a hub to connect the shaft.
